How to Strengthen Your WordPress Database Security with These Tips

Your WordPress database is the heart of your website, storing all your content, user data, and settings. Keeping it secure is crucial to prevent data breaches, website downtime, and potential financial losses. Here are some tips to strengthen your WordPress database security:

1. Use Strong Passwords and Authentication:

  • Secure your database user: Don’t use the default "root" user for your WordPress database. Create a new user with limited privileges for accessing WordPress data.
  • Strong passwords: Choose complex and unique passwords for both your database user and your WordPress admin account. Use a password manager to generate and store strong passwords securely.
  • Two-factor authentication (2FA): Enable 2FA for your WordPress admin account and any other sensitive accounts. This adds an extra layer of security by requiring a second verification step, usually a code sent to your phone or email.

2. Keep Your WordPress Core and Plugins Updated:

  • Regular updates: WordPress releases security patches regularly to address vulnerabilities. Always update your WordPress core, plugins, and themes as soon as new updates are available.
  • Use reputable plugins: Choose trusted and well-maintained plugins from reputable developers. Avoid installing plugins from unknown sources or those with poor reviews.

3. Implement Security Measures:

  • Firewall: Install a web application firewall (WAF) to protect your website from malicious attacks like SQL injection, cross-site scripting, and brute-force attacks.
  • Security plugins: Consider using security plugins like WordFence, Sucuri, or iThemes Security. These plugins offer a range of features, including malware scanning, firewall protection, and security hardening.
  • Database backups: Regularly back up your WordPress database to ensure you can restore it in case of data loss or corruption.

4. Protect Your Website from Brute Force Attacks:

  • Limit login attempts: Configure your WordPress settings to limit the number of login attempts allowed. This helps prevent brute-force attacks that try to guess passwords.
  • Use a strong login security plugin: Plugins like Loginizer or Limit Login Attempts can help further protect your website from brute force attacks by blocking suspicious IPs and enforcing more stringent login rules.
  • Enable captcha: Use a CAPTCHA system to verify that login attempts are made by humans, not bots.

5. Follow Best Practices:

  • Use secure file transfer protocol (SFTP): Use SFTP to transfer files to your server instead of FTP, which is less secure.
  • Avoid using sensitive data in your database: Store sensitive information like credit card details or personal data in a separate, secure system.
  • Monitor your website logs: Regularly check your website logs for suspicious activity. This can help identify potential security threats and take action quickly.

By implementing these tips, you can significantly strengthen the security of your WordPress database and protect your website from potential threats. Remember, staying vigilant and following best practices is essential for maintaining a secure online presence.

Leave a Reply

Your email address will not be published. Required fields are marked *

Trending